Palabra.ai
+ Delivers both translated audio and captions simultaneously
+ Strong developer story with SDKs for embedding into other platforms
- Self-reported low-latency and accuracy claims are hard to independently verify
VEED
+ Runs entirely in the browser with no software to install
+ Combines transcription, captioning, and video editing in one workflow
- Geared toward content creation rather than dedicated meeting note-taking
